Igbajo Polytechnic Part-time (ND/HND) Admission – Igbajo Polytechnic, the first community-owned Polytechnic in Nigeria in Boluwaduro Local Government Area, State of Osun, approved and accredited by the NBTE, invites applications from suitably qualified candidates for admission into its Full-time HND andΒ Β ND/HND DAILY/WEEKEND PART-TIME Programmes as indicated below:

ENTRY REQUIREMENTS FOR ND COURSES

5 Credit Passes in English Language, Mathematics, and in any other three relevant subjects at GCE ‘O’ Level, WASC, NECO & NABTEB at not more than two sittings.
Waiver: 4 Credit Passes with a deficiency in one of the major subjects may be considered for a student applying for daily part-time.

ADMISSION REQUIREMENTS FOR HND COURSES

-As in ND Courses above

-ND Certificate of Igbajo Polytechnic or other Government approved Polytechnic, with at least a Lower Credit grade.
Evidence of one year Industrial Training
